xref: /aosp_15_r20/external/icu/icu4c/source/test/testdata/pkgdataMakefile.in (revision 0e209d3975ff4a8c132096b14b0e9364a753506e)
1*0e209d39SAndroid Build Coastguard Worker## pkgdataMakefile.in for ICU data
2*0e209d39SAndroid Build Coastguard Worker## Copyright (C) 2016 and later: Unicode, Inc. and others.
3*0e209d39SAndroid Build Coastguard Worker## License & terms of use: http://www.unicode.org/copyright.html
4*0e209d39SAndroid Build Coastguard Worker## Copyright (c) 2008-2012, International Business Machines Corporation and
5*0e209d39SAndroid Build Coastguard Worker## others. All Rights Reserved.
6*0e209d39SAndroid Build Coastguard Worker
7*0e209d39SAndroid Build Coastguard Worker## Source directory information
8*0e209d39SAndroid Build Coastguard Workersrcdir = @srcdir@
9*0e209d39SAndroid Build Coastguard Workertop_srcdir = @top_srcdir@
10*0e209d39SAndroid Build Coastguard Worker
11*0e209d39SAndroid Build Coastguard Worker# So that you have $(top_builddir)/config.status
12*0e209d39SAndroid Build Coastguard Workertop_builddir = ../..
13*0e209d39SAndroid Build Coastguard Worker
14*0e209d39SAndroid Build Coastguard Worker## All the flags and other definitions are included here.
15*0e209d39SAndroid Build Coastguard Workerinclude $(top_builddir)/icudefs.mk
16*0e209d39SAndroid Build Coastguard Worker
17*0e209d39SAndroid Build Coastguard WorkerOUTPUTFILE=pkgdata.inc
18*0e209d39SAndroid Build Coastguard WorkerMIDDLE_SO_TARGET=
19*0e209d39SAndroid Build Coastguard WorkerPKGDATA_TRAILING_SPACE=" "
20*0e209d39SAndroid Build Coastguard Worker
21*0e209d39SAndroid Build Coastguard Workerall : clean
22*0e209d39SAndroid Build Coastguard Worker	@echo GENCCODE_ASSEMBLY_TYPE=$(GENCCODE_ASSEMBLY) >> $(OUTPUTFILE)
23*0e209d39SAndroid Build Coastguard Worker	@echo SO=$(SO) >> $(OUTPUTFILE)
24*0e209d39SAndroid Build Coastguard Worker	@echo SOBJ=$(SOBJ) >> $(OUTPUTFILE)
25*0e209d39SAndroid Build Coastguard Worker	@echo A=$(A) >> $(OUTPUTFILE)
26*0e209d39SAndroid Build Coastguard Worker	@echo LIBPREFIX=$(LIBPREFIX)$(STATIC_PREFIX_WHEN_USED) >> $(OUTPUTFILE)
27*0e209d39SAndroid Build Coastguard Worker	@echo LIB_EXT_ORDER=$(FINAL_SO_TARGET) >> $(OUTPUTFILE)
28*0e209d39SAndroid Build Coastguard Worker	@echo COMPILE="$(COMPILE.c)" >> $(OUTPUTFILE)
29*0e209d39SAndroid Build Coastguard Worker	@echo LIBFLAGS="-I$(top_srcdir)/common -I$(top_builddir)/common $(SHAREDLIBCPPFLAGS) $(SHAREDLIBCFLAGS)" >> $(OUTPUTFILE)
30*0e209d39SAndroid Build Coastguard Worker	@echo GENLIB="$(SHLIB.c)" >> $(OUTPUTFILE)
31*0e209d39SAndroid Build Coastguard Worker	@echo LDICUDTFLAGS=$(LDFLAGSICUDT) >> $(OUTPUTFILE)
32*0e209d39SAndroid Build Coastguard Worker	@echo LD_SONAME=$(LD_SONAME) >> $(OUTPUTFILE)
33*0e209d39SAndroid Build Coastguard Worker	@echo RPATH_FLAGS=$(RPATH_FLAGS) >> $(OUTPUTFILE)
34*0e209d39SAndroid Build Coastguard Worker	@echo BIR_LDFLAGS=$(BIR_LDFLAGS) >> $(OUTPUTFILE)
35*0e209d39SAndroid Build Coastguard Worker	@echo AR=$(AR) >> $(OUTPUTFILE)
36*0e209d39SAndroid Build Coastguard Worker	@echo ARFLAGS=$(ARFLAGS) >> $(OUTPUTFILE)
37*0e209d39SAndroid Build Coastguard Worker	@echo RANLIB=$(RANLIB) >> $(OUTPUTFILE)
38*0e209d39SAndroid Build Coastguard Worker	@echo INSTALL_CMD=$(INSTALL) >> $(OUTPUTFILE)
39*0e209d39SAndroid Build Coastguard Worker
40*0e209d39SAndroid Build Coastguard Workerclean :
41*0e209d39SAndroid Build Coastguard Worker	$(RMV) $(OUTPUTFILE)
42*0e209d39SAndroid Build Coastguard Worker
43